Culinary Bite logo

The Recipe Extractor: Unlocking the Culinary Secrets

Recipe extraction process
Recipe extraction process

Introduction to Recipe Extraction

Recipe extraction is a revolutionary technology that has gained significant importance in the world of culinary science. It involves the process of analyzing and extracting key information from recipes, such as ingredients and cooking instructions. This article aims to explore the concept of recipe extraction and its applications in the field of food research, development, and innovation. By understanding how recipe extraction works and its benefits, we can unlock the secrets of culinary creations and pave the way for new culinary possibilities.

What is Recipe Extraction?

Recipe extraction refers to the automated process of extracting structured data from unstructured recipe text. It involves using natural language processing techniques to analyze the textual information and identify relevant information such as ingredient names, quantities, cooking methods, and preparation steps. By extracting this information, recipe extraction technology enables the conversion of unstructured recipe data into a structured format that can be easily analyzed and utilized for various purposes.

Importance of Recipe Extraction in Culinary Science

Recipe extraction plays a vital role in culinary science by providing valuable insights into the composition and characteristics of various recipes. It allows researchers and food developers to gain a comprehensive understanding of the ingredients used, their quantities, and the techniques employed in different culinary preparations. This information is crucial for studying the nutritional content, flavor profiles, and sensory attributes of recipes. With recipe extraction, culinary scientists can delve deeper into the intricacies of recipes, enabling them to make informed decisions regarding ingredient substitutions, recipe modifications, and new product development.

Furthermore, recipe extraction facilitates innovation in the culinary field by enabling the discovery of new flavor combinations and cooking techniques. By analyzing large volumes of recipes, researchers can identify emerging food trends, regional variations, and cultural influences on culinary traditions. This knowledge can be leveraged to create innovative recipes, develop new products, and enhance the overall culinary experience for consumers.

Despite its immense potential, recipe extraction also poses certain challenges. One of the main challenges is the variability and ambiguity in recipe language. Recipes are often written in a descriptive manner, with variations in ingredient names, measurements, and cooking terminologies. Recipe extraction algorithms need to account for these variations and uncertainties to ensure accurate and reliable results.

How Recipe Extraction Works

Data Collection and Preprocessing

Recipe extraction is a process that involves extracting relevant information from food recipes in order to analyze, organize, and utilize the data. The first step in recipe extraction is data collection. This involves sourcing recipes from various platforms such as cookbooks, cooking websites, and online databases. The recipes collected can vary in formats, styles, and structures.

Once the recipes are collected, the next step is preprocessing the data. This involves cleaning and structuring the recipe data to ensure consistency and ease of analysis. During the preprocessing stage, irrelevant information such as advertisements, images, and user comments are removed. The remaining text is then parsed to identify key components such as ingredients, quantities, and cooking instructions.

Text Parsing and Ingredient Identification

Text parsing is a crucial part of recipe extraction as it involves breaking down the recipe text into meaningful components. Natural language processing techniques are applied to parse the text and identify the different sections of a recipe, such as the ingredient list, preparation steps, and cooking methods.

Ingredient identification is a significant aspect of recipe extraction. The extracted text is analyzed to identify individual ingredients and their corresponding quantities. This process requires advanced algorithms and machine learning techniques to accurately recognize and categorize ingredients in different variations or forms. For example, the algorithm should be able to identify "1 cup of diced tomatoes" as a single ingredient with the quantity and the ingredient name.

Food research and development
Food research and development

Quantitative Analysis of Recipes

Once the recipe data has been parsed and the ingredients have been identified, quantitative analysis can be conducted. This involves analyzing the ingredients and their quantities to derive valuable insights. For example, the total calorie count, nutritional value, or cost of a recipe can be calculated based on the ingredients and their respective quantities.

Quantitative analysis also enables the comparison of multiple recipes. By analyzing the ingredients and their proportions across various recipes, patterns and trends can be identified. This information can be beneficial for food research, development, and innovation. For instance, it can help in identifying popular ingredients, regional variations, or even potential ingredient substitutions for specific dietary needs.

Applications of Recipe Extraction

Recipe extraction has various applications in the culinary world, revolutionizing the way we approach food research, development, and innovation. By unlocking the secrets of culinary creations, recipe extraction offers valuable insights and opportunities for chefs, food scientists, and the food industry as a whole.

Recipe Analysis and Optimization

One significant application of recipe extraction is in recipe analysis and optimization. By extracting key information from recipes, such as ingredient proportions, cooking techniques, and flavor combinations, chefs and food scientists can analyze and evaluate recipes more comprehensively. This data-driven approach enables them to identify patterns, understand the impact of specific ingredients or techniques, and optimize recipes for flavor, nutrition, or even cost-effectiveness.

Recipe extraction also allows for the comparison of multiple recipes, which can be particularly useful when developing new dishes or improving existing ones. Chefs and researchers can examine different recipes for the same dish and identify similarities and differences in ingredients and techniques. This analysis helps in creating new variations, enhancing flavors, and identifying innovative combinations to delight the taste buds of discerning food enthusiasts.

New Recipe Development

Another exciting application of recipe extraction is in new recipe development. Chefs and food innovators are constantly seeking fresh ideas and unique flavor profiles to captivate their audience. By using recipe extraction tools, they can analyze a vast database of recipes, identify emerging trends, and discover novel ingredients, techniques, or flavor combinations.

Recipe extraction aids in the creative process by providing inspiration and a wealth of knowledge from countless recipes across different cuisines and cultures. Chefs can draw insights from various sources and use them as a springboard to develop innovative, boundary-pushing recipes that redefine culinary boundaries.

Menu Planning and Dietary Assessment

Recipe extraction also plays a crucial role in menu planning and dietary assessment. By extracting key information from recipes, such as ingredient lists and nutritional data, chefs, nutritionists, and dieticians can create well-balanced menus that cater to specific dietary requirements or health goals.

This technology allows for the efficient analysis of recipes on a large scale, enabling the identification of allergens, calorie counts, macronutrient distribution, and other nutritional information. By using recipe extraction, food establishments can provide accurate and detailed dietary information to their customers, promoting transparency and accommodating a wide range of dietary preferences or restrictions.

In addition, recipe extraction aids in the assessment and monitoring of dietary patterns and nutritional trends. Researchers and health professionals can analyze recipes extracted from various sources to understand consumption patterns, identify areas for improvement, and develop evidence-based guidelines for healthy eating.

Innovation in the culinary world
Innovation in the culinary world

Recipe extraction is a powerful tool that holds tremendous potential for the culinary world. From recipe analysis and optimization to new recipe development and menu planning, this technology empowers chefs, researchers, and food industry professionals to unlock the secrets of culinary creations, driving innovation and delighting taste buds around the globe.

Benefits of Using Recipe Extractors

Efficiency and Time-saving

Recipe extractors offer significant benefits in terms of efficiency and time-saving in the culinary world. By automating the process of extracting recipe data, chefs and food researchers can save precious hours that would otherwise be spent manually inputting and organizing recipe information. With recipe extractors, the time-consuming task of manually transcribing recipes can be eliminated, allowing culinary professionals to focus on more creative and innovative aspects of their work.

Accuracy and Consistency

Recipe extractors ensure a high level of accuracy and consistency in recipe data. Human error is minimized, as the technology is designed to extract and record recipe information with precision. This ensures that recipes are faithfully reproduced, maintaining their integrity and ensuring that the final dish is prepared as intended. With the use of recipe extractors, chefs and food researchers can rely on consistent and reliable recipe data, resulting in consistent culinary creations.

Enhanced Innovation and Creativity

Recipe extractors open up new avenues for innovation and creativity in the culinary world. By automating the process of recipe extraction, chefs and food researchers can easily access a vast database of recipes, providing inspiration for new dishes and culinary experiments. The ability to quickly search and analyze recipe data allows for the identification of patterns, trends, and unique flavor combinations, fostering innovation and pushing the boundaries of culinary creativity.

Challenges in Recipe Extraction

Variability in Recipe Formats

One of the major challenges in recipe extraction is the variability in recipe formats. Recipes can be found in various formats, including traditional cookbooks, online blogs, recipe cards, and even handwritten notes. Each format has its own unique structure and organization, making it difficult to extract information consistently.

For instance, some recipes may list ingredients first, followed by step-by-step instructions, while others may provide a narrative description of the cooking process. This variability in formats poses a challenge for recipe extractors, as they need to understand and adapt to different structures to accurately extract the relevant information.

Ambiguity in Ingredient Terminology

Another challenge in recipe extraction is the ambiguity in ingredient terminology. Ingredients can be referred to in multiple ways, including alternative names, brands, and even regional variations. For example, "coriander" may be called "cilantro" in some regions, and "eggplant" may be referred to as "aubergine" in others.

This ambiguity makes it difficult for recipe extractors to accurately identify and categorize ingredients. It requires advanced natural language processing techniques to understand the context and variations in ingredient terminology, ensuring accurate extraction of ingredient information.

Tips for effective use of recipe extractors
Tips for effective use of recipe extractors

Complexity of Recipe Structures

Recipe structures can be complex, with multiple layers of sub-recipes, variations, and optional steps. For instance, a main recipe may include sub-recipes for sauces or toppings, with each having its own set of ingredients and instructions. Additionally, recipes may provide variations or optional steps, depending on dietary preferences or ingredient availability.

Extracting information from such complex recipe structures requires advanced algorithms and techniques. Recipe extractors need to navigate through these structures, identify the relevant information, and present it in a coherent and organized manner.

Practical Tips for Using Recipe Extractors

Choose the Right Recipe Extraction Tool

When it comes to using recipe extractors, selecting the right tool is crucial. There are various software and online platforms available that claim to extract recipes accurately. However, not all of them deliver the same level of precision and reliability.

To choose the right recipe extraction tool, consider factors such as the tool's reputation, user reviews, and the features it offers. Look for tools that have a proven track record of accurately extracting recipes and providing the necessary data in an organized format. Additionally, ensure that the tool is compatible with the types of recipes you intend to extract.

Validate and Verify Extracted Data

Once you have extracted the recipe data using a recipe extraction tool, it is essential to validate and verify the accuracy of the extracted information. Recipe extractors may not always capture every detail correctly, and there can be instances where the extracted data might contain errors or inconsistencies.

To ensure the accuracy of the extracted data, cross-reference it with reliable sources such as cookbooks or reputable cooking websites. Check for any missing ingredients, incorrect measurements, or unclear instructions. By validating and verifying the extracted data, you can ensure that you have reliable information to work with.

Consider the Limitations of Recipe Extractors

While recipe extractors can be a valuable tool in the culinary world, it is important to be aware of their limitations. Recipe extraction technology is continually evolving, but it is not yet perfect. Some challenges you may encounter include:

  • Incomplete or inaccurate ingredient lists: Recipe extractors may not always capture all the ingredients accurately, especially if they are listed in a different format or order than what the tool is programmed to recognize.
  • Ambiguous instructions: Recipe extractors may struggle with extracting precise cooking instructions, particularly if the instructions are written in a complex or unconventional manner.
  • Language and formatting issues: Recipe extractors might encounter difficulties with recipes in different languages or with unique formatting styles.

By understanding these limitations, you can make informed decisions and take necessary steps to verify and correct any inaccuracies or missing information.

Remember, recipe extractors are tools that can assist in the process of recipe extraction, but they should not replace human judgment and expertise. Always use your culinary knowledge and intuition to ensure the quality and accuracy of the recipes you extract.

Conclusion

The future of recipe extraction looks promising. As technology continues to advance, we can expect recipe extractors to become more sophisticated and accurate in their analysis. This will further enhance our understanding of the complexities of food and how different ingredients interact with each other. With these insights, chefs and food scientists can push the boundaries of culinary creativity and create dishes that are not only delicious but also visually stunning.

Unlocking the secrets of culinary creations through recipe extraction opens up a world of possibilities. It allows us to delve deeper into the art and science of cooking, uncovering new techniques and flavor combinations that were previously unknown. By harnessing the power of technology, we can continue to innovate and push the boundaries of what is possible in the culinary world.

In summary, recipe extraction is a game-changer for the food industry. It provides a comprehensive understanding of recipes, enabling chefs and researchers to create new and exciting dishes. As technology advances, we can expect recipe extraction to play an even greater role in culinary research and development. With its potential to unlock the secrets of culinary creations, recipe extraction is poised to shape the future of food.

Selection of Fresh Ingredients
Selection of Fresh Ingredients
Discover the steps to create a mouthwatering hot pot recipe that will impress even the most discerning palates. From selecting the freshest ingredients to mastering the art of broth preparation, this article guides you through the process of making a delectable hot pot dish. 🍲
Elegant Snowflake Cookie
Elegant Snowflake Cookie
Indulge in a delightful array πŸͺ of Christmas cookies with these exclusive recipes from the esteemed Food Network. Elevate your holiday baking with festive treats that will leave your taste buds craving for more!
Elegant chilled chicken noodle soup presented on a fine china bowl
Elegant chilled chicken noodle soup presented on a fine china bowl
Unleash your culinary prowess with our delectable cold chicken noodle soup recipe 🍲 Embark on a journey of freshness and flavor unmatched by any ordinary dish. Elevate your cooking skills and treat your taste buds to pure delight!
A bowl of plain yogurt with a swirl of honey
A bowl of plain yogurt with a swirl of honey
Explore in-depth the sugar content in plain yogurt, discover the impact on your health, and make informed dietary decisions πŸ₯„πŸ“Š #yogurt #sugaranalysis #healthyeating